Product Overview

Category

The NVMFS5C450NWFAFT3G belongs to the category of power MOSFETs.

Use

It is used as a high-performance solution for various power management applications.

Characteristics

  • High efficiency
  • Low on-resistance
  • Fast switching speed
  • Low gate charge

Package

The NVMFS5C450NWFAFT3G is available in a compact and efficient package suitable for surface mount applications.

Essence

This MOSFET is designed to provide reliable and efficient power management solutions in a wide range of electronic devices and systems.

Packaging/Quantity

The NVMFS5C450NWFAFT3G is typically packaged in reels and is available in varying quantities based on customer requirements.

Specifications

  • Voltage Rating: 40V
  • Continuous Drain Current: 120A
  • RDS(ON): 1.8mΩ
  • Package Type: Power33
